Mnemonic story
This character is a pictograph representing a traditional garment. The top part (亠) symbolizes the collar or shoulders, while the lower strokes depict the sleeves and the hem hanging down. It is used to mean 'clothes' in words like garment (衣服) or the essentials of life: food, clothing, and shelter (衣食住).
